An analysis of the mechanism of formation of composite nanoparticles of Ag/Si shows that it depends on their stoichiometric composition, conditions of condensation and crystallisation. During the crystallisation of the nanoparticle core, eutectics consisting of silver and silicon layers are formed. Diffraction fringes in the nanoparticle core are caused by the formation of eutectic platelets during crystallisation of phase components. Layers of the conductor Ag and semiconductor Si form, creating an electric charge at the boundaries. We demonstrate the dependence of the sizes of these Ag/Si nanoparticles on the rates of heating and cooling of the materials during synthesis.
